The Setup Man by T.T. Monday - 262 pages
Johnny Adcock is an aging relief pitcher with a side job as a private detective for his fellow major league baseball players with sensitive problems. This premise sounds bizarre but it works and the noir tone elevates the story to a higher level. The world is fully fleshed out and the characters have depth from the moment you meet them. As a baseball fan, I truly enjoyed this diversion from the traditional detective format with its look behind the scenes into that elite world. Just a note - there is heavy violence in this book so it is by no means a "cozy" mystery.
